WebSep 10, 2024 · Coupled inductors are used in various applications depending on their windings. 1:1 winding ratio inductors are for increasing electrical isolation or series … WebOct 27, 2024 · A capacitance of 1 farad (1 F) represents a current flow of 1 A while there is a voltage increase of 1 V/s. A capacitance of 1 F also results in 1 V of potential difference for an electric charge of 1 C. A farad is a huge unit of capacitance. You’ll almost never see a capacitor with a value of 1 F.

Voltage … WebDec 17, 2016 · The important types of fixed capacitors are: Ceramic capacitors. Film and paper capacitors. Aluminum, tantalum, and niobium electrolytic capacitors. Polymer capacitors. Supercapacitor. Silver mica, glass, silicon, air-gap, and vacuum capacitors. Many capacitors got their names from the dielectric used in them.
